The State of Wireless Technology in 2025
Wireless mechanical keyboards have come a long way since the early days of unreliable Bluetooth connections. Today, three main wireless technologies dominate the market: Bluetooth 5.3+, 2.4 GHz wireless, and proprietary low-latency protocols. The 2.4 GHz standard, in particular, has closed the gap with wired connections, offering sub-1ms latency that many gamers find indistinguishable from a cable. Meanwhile, Bluetooth has improved with adaptive frequency hopping and lower power consumption, making it ideal for multi-device users.

Latency: The Great Equalizer
Latency—the time between pressing a key and seeing the action on screen—has historically been the Achilles' heel of wireless keyboards. However, 2025's advancements in polling rates and receiver technology have changed the game. Wired keyboards typically offer a 1000 Hz polling rate (1ms response), while high-end wireless models now match or exceed this. Real-World Latency Comparisons
| Connection Type | Typical Latency (ms) | Best Use Case |
|---|---|---|
| Wired (USB) | 1-2 ms | Competitive gaming, professional typing |
| 2.4 GHz Wireless | 1-3 ms | High-performance gaming, low-latency tasks |
| Bluetooth 5.3 | 4-10 ms | Casual use, multi-device setups |
For most users, the difference between wired and 2.4 GHz wireless is imperceptible in everyday use. Only professional esports players or those with extremely sensitive reflexes might notice a slight edge with a wired connection. However, for office work or general typing, Bluetooth's convenience often outweighs the minimal latency penalty.
Battery Life: From Days to Months
Battery life is where wireless keyboards have made the most dramatic improvements. Early models required weekly charging, but 2025's designs—especially those with hot-swappable switches and efficient Bluetooth chips—can last months on a single charge. Key factors include:
- Battery capacity: Many 2025 keyboards pack 4000mAh or larger batteries.
- Backlighting: RGB lighting can drain a battery in days, while no backlight extends life significantly.
- Wireless protocol: 2.4 GHz often consumes more power than Bluetooth, but newer chips are more efficient.

Performance: Wired Still Wins for Reliability
While wireless technology has caught up in raw latency, wired connections still offer unbeatable reliability. No interference, no pairing issues, and no battery anxiety. For mission-critical applications like competitive gaming tournaments or professional video editing, a wired keyboard remains the safest choice. However, for daily use, the freedom of wireless—especially with a 2.4 GHz connection—often outweighs the minor reliability trade-offs.
Key performance considerations include:
- Polling rate stability: Wired connections maintain consistent 1000 Hz, while wireless can drop under heavy interference.
